Control Wiring (Option 3): Utilizing a Zone Panel

1.Set “DHWP on TT” (see programming section for instructions).

2.Set “C1 on TT” (default, see programming section for instructions).

3.Circulator-on and -off delay will only effect DHW zone.

4.A call for heat on TT (from the DHW zone) will change boiler set point to the high limit. All other zones will heat to the reset temperature determined by the HeatManager.

5.Ensure that the zone panel and AquaSmart are powered from the same service switch.
